Episode Summary Championship culture is how Frederick Dudek (Freddy D) explains the connection between consistency, trust, and advocacy in Business Superfans® Advantage Episode 202. Championship culture creates advocacy when employees, contractors, vendors, and partners experience clear, repeated standards they can trust . In a service business, that consistency shapes how people serve clients, represent the brand, and talk about the company, turning everyday stakeholders into advocates who strengthen reputation, referrals, and revenue . In this episode, Frederick Dudek shows why service businesses often blame marketing when growth slows, even though the deeper problem is inconsistent culture . Using lessons from Pete Carroll and Chris Carlisle , he explains how repeated messaging , trust-based leadership , and observable behavior standards help businesses build advocacy from the inside out and activate the R⁶ Reactor™ .
